Transaction 101a8b42d2e42eaba70c828fb0f3b0b0151eb5b8904ab84c53d118502690016f
1 Input
2 Outputs
- 101a8b42d2e42eaba70c828fb0f3b0b0151eb5b8904ab84c53d118502690016f:0
- 101a8b42d2e42eaba70c828fb0f3b0b0151eb5b8904ab84c53d118502690016f:1
value 20756
address 3C7pSH1NTNU814ggdCrJmDmeSy42rizzGE
value 2772307
address 1DQ7o9YeFUm9HjQig8v1Rua1ZMbdxVq3UN